Suppose the government wants to reduce the total pollution emitted by three local firms. Currently, each firm is creating 4 units of pollution in the area, for a total of 12 pollution units. If the government wants to reduce total pollution in the area to 6 units, it can choose between the following two methods:

Based on the above calculation for both regulation and tradable permits we can come to conclusion that elimination of pollution will be LESS costly to the society in a situation where the government distributes tradable permits because tradable permits is cheaper than regulation.

Emissions trading is a market-based strategy to pollution control that creates financial incentives for polluters to reduce their emissions.
